A detailed code of conduct sets out the standards of conduct expected of panel members in carrying out their role.
The regional panel members must:
- act honestly, ethically and responsibly
- exercise a reasonable degree of care and diligence
- act in a way that enhances public confidence in the integrity of the role of the regional panels.
The regional panel members must avoid, manage and disclose conflicts of interest, which include pecuniary or non-pecuniary interests, political donations and other business and personal dealings.
The code of conduct also outlines complaint and disciplinary procedures.
